Before the dumpster even gets delivered, among the best things you can do is organize the materials you intend to dispose of. Sorting your items in advance makes it simpler to visualize how they will fit in the dumpster. Start by categorizing your waste into bulky, heavy, recyclable, and smaller.

Taking the time to declutter and sort your items before your rental ensures you can dispose of as much as possible while optimizing the space. If possible, consider giving away or recycling items that do not need to be discarded. This simple step can free up space for materials indeed headed for disposal.

When your dumpster is delivered, begin loading it with the heaviest items first. These are typically your bulkier items, such as furniture, appliances, or large construction debris. Loading the heavy items at the bottom of the dumpster is important for create a stable foundation for the rest of your waste.

Breaking down large items into manageable pieces can make a huge difference in optimizing the available space. For instance, disassembling a table or cutting big wood pieces into smaller parts allows you save space for lighter items. The more compact your waste is, the more efficient you'll be at filling the dumpster.

One of the most frequent mistakes people make when filling a dumpster is not taking full advantage of the vertical space. At 402 Container, we recommend stacking items in layers to utilize the entire height of the dumpster. After placing heavier items at the bottom, you must continue filling the dumpster from the ground up with smaller items.

Stack things like boxes, scrap metal, and smaller debris upward. Not only does this maximize the space, but makes it simpler to fit items in tight spots that would otherwise go unused.

Once youhave filled larger items, check for gaps in between. These empty spaces are prime for filling with lighter, smaller materials such as waste bags, newspapers, or small household items. Utilizing every small opening ensures you get the most out of your rental.
Pack more negligible yard waste, like leaves or branches, into these empty spaces. By filling every nook and cranny, you’ll be able to fit more debris and avoid wasting valuable space.

As you fill your dumpster, it's crucial to consider weight distribution. A lopsided load can lead to issues throughout transportation and my link even damage the dumpster. Start by placing the heaviest items in the center of the dumpster and slowly build outward with lighter materials.

This balanced approach helps maintain the integrity of the dumpster while ensuring that everything stays secure. It also makes the loading process smoother and avoids difficulty picking up the dumpster.

Although squeezing in as much as possible may seem ideal, it's essential not to overload the dumpster. An overfilled dumpster poses a hazard to both safety and the environment. If your dumpster is filled above the above the top edge and doesn't close securely, it can create dangerous conditions during transport.

At 402 Container, we emphasize the significance of filling the dumpster only to the fill line and no higher. If your dumpster is overfilled, you may incur extra charges. Plus, keeping the load even and balanced helps safe transport.

Specific items, such as toxic materials, electronics, or large appliances, might need special handling. If you intend to dispose of materials like these, let us know beforehand so we can accommodate your needs. Some items are not allowed in regular dumpsters, and we can guide you through the correct disposal procedures.

Awareness of the restrictions on your dumpster rental helps avoid complications later on. We’re here to help you navigate any specific disposal needs for your project.
